WEAVER v. REALTY GROWTH INVESTORS

No. 214, September Term, 1977.

38 Md. App. 78 (1977)

379 A.2d 193

WILLIAM E. WEAVER v. REALTY GROWTH INVESTORS.

Court of Special Appeals of Maryland.

Decided November 14, 1977.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

Ira C. Wolpert, with whom were Ronald M. Hirschel, Sheldon B. Kamins and Deckelbaum, Wolpert & Ogens on the brief, for appellant.

David F. Albright and Alan N. Gamse, with whom were Robert B. Haldeman and Semmes, Bowen & Semmes on the brief, for appellee.

The cause was argued before THOMPSON, MELVIN and WILNER, JJ.


WILNER, J., delivered the opinion of the Court.

We are asked here to consider whether the Circuit Court for Worcester County abused its discretion in refusing to set aside what appellant claims was a "judgment by default" entered against him.
